diff options
author | (quasar) nebula <qznebula@protonmail.com> | 2025-02-18 17:35:35 -0400 |
---|---|---|
committer | (quasar) nebula <qznebula@protonmail.com> | 2025-03-02 08:23:22 -0400 |
commit | eedd05e6aa40d050851d877a3be90bc5b17dd5f8 (patch) | |
tree | 1da6efe75a38e30f095df272ecbc724871e83a60 /src/content/dependencies/generateCommentarySection.js | |
parent | ae08fc94a062554c479c4ba6c4367d31dd157a4f (diff) |
content: inline generateCommentarySection behavior
Diffstat (limited to 'src/content/dependencies/generateCommentarySection.js')
-rw-r--r-- | src/content/dependencies/generateCommentarySection.js | 38 |
1 files changed, 0 insertions, 38 deletions
diff --git a/src/content/dependencies/generateCommentarySection.js b/src/content/dependencies/generateCommentarySection.js deleted file mode 100644 index 0be81c3b..00000000 --- a/src/content/dependencies/generateCommentarySection.js +++ /dev/null @@ -1,38 +0,0 @@ -export default { - contentDependencies: [ - 'transformContent', - 'generateCommentaryEntry', - 'generateContentHeading', - ], - - extraDependencies: ['html', 'language'], - - relations: (relation, entries) => ({ - heading: - relation('generateContentHeading'), - - entries: - entries.map(entry => - relation('generateCommentaryEntry', entry)), - }), - - slots: { - title: {type: 'html', mutable: false}, - id: {type: 'string', default: 'artist-commentary'}, - }, - - generate: (relations, slots, {html, language}) => - html.tags([ - relations.heading - .slots({ - title: - (html.isBlank(slots.title) - ? language.$('misc.artistCommentary') - : slots.title), - - attributes: {id: slots.id}, - }), - - relations.entries, - ]), -}; |